One of my best girlfriends has asked me to be a bridesmaid. I'm overjoyed that she wants me to be a part of this with her. I am also a professional beautician and own my own salon. I was recently notified that she expects me to do her hair and nails, as well as all the bridesmaids and the mothers, but she honestly doesn't think she should have to pay since I'm a friend of hers. I was thinking I could do her as a gift but charge for everyone else. Is that ok? If so who is suppose to pay?

Every member of the bridal party should be paying for their own hair and makeup. If you want to pay for the bride, great. Just offer her a price list and let her know your expectations.
